M = Manifold(4, 'M', structure='Lorentzian')
# X.<t, r, th, ph> = M.chart(r't r:(0,+oo) th:(0,pi):\theta ph:(0,2*pi):periodic:\phi')
X.<t, r, th, ph> = M.chart(r't r:(0,+oo) th:(0,pi):\theta ph:\phi')
X
g = M.metric()
m = 1
g[0,0] = -(1-2*m/r)
g[1,1] = 1/(1-2*m/r)
g[2,2] = r^2
g[3,3] = (r*sin(th))^2
g.display()

We consider a null geodesic in the equatorial plane $\theta=\pi/2$ arising from far away of the black hole with an impact parameter very close to the critical value $b_c = 3\sqrt{3} m$:
bc = 3*sqrt(3)
n(bc)
b = 5.196155
n(b - bc)
We introduce a function to compute the initial tangent vector from the value of $b$, the conserved energy $E$ and the coordinates $(r_0,\varphi_0)$ of the initial point:
def initial_vector(r0, b, ph0=0, E=1, inward=False):
t0, th0 = 0, pi/2
L = b*E
vt0 = 1/(1-2*m/r0)
vr0 = sqrt(E^2 - L^2/r0^2*(1-2*m/r0))
if inward:
vr0 = - vr0
vth0 = 0
vph0 = L / r0^2
p0 = M((t0, r0, th0, ph0), name='p_0')
return M.tangent_space(p0)((vt0, vr0, vth0, vph0), name='v_0')
r0 = 15 # distance of the source
import time
graph = circle((0, 0), 2*m, edgecolor='black', fill=True, facecolor='grey', alpha=0.5)
ph0 = asin(b/r0)
v0 = initial_vector(r0, b, ph0=ph0, inward=True)
s = var('s')
geod0 = M.integrated_geodesic(g, (s, 0, 50), v0)
time0 = time.time()
#sol = geod0.solve(step=0.1, method="odeint")
sol = geod0.solve(step=0.1, method="odeint", rtol=1.e-12, atol=1.e-12)
print("CPU time in solve(): {} s".format(time.time() - time0))
interp = geod0.interpolate()
graph += geod0.plot_integrated(chart=Xcart, ambient_coords=(x,y), plot_points=500,
aspect_ratio=1, color='green')
show(graph, xmin=-10, xmax=10, ymin=-10, ymax=10, axes_labels=[r'$x/m$', r'$y/m$'])
CPU time in solve(): 0.026593446731567383 s
